Hang it up or take it down
At first glance, the "Hang Sack" looks like an ordinary, simple small pouch. However, it is actually an item full of ingenious features typical of "OGAWAND." The Velcro-fastened opening is a flap type, and when you flip it up, another layer of Velcro is revealed. This part has Velcro on both sides and employs "OGAWAND's" original "Hang System" mechanism, which allows it to connect to the opening of the "pad sleeve" (the part for storing the back pad) inside the backpack. The attachment method is also very simple: just stick the Velcro together and "sandwich and hang."
While hiking in the mountains, it's best to store essential items like your wallet and car keys—things you absolutely cannot afford to lose—inside your backpack. However, these are also items you want to be able to quickly access when needed. The "Hang Sack" is a unique pouch that can be used as an inner pocket during your hike, and then quickly retrieved and used as a shoulder bag after descending or arriving at a mountain hut.
